BEAT 01

Challenge Intro

OPENING00:00.000:09.8 · 6 shots

It frames an immediate real-world test: “My new Pulseo 10s mod has just come in the mail so let’s see if it lives up to the 3005 star reviews it has on Trustpilot.” That “let’s see if it lives up” sets up the video as a verification challenge that the viewer is about to watch get resolved.

Why this works:This leverages Challenge Appraisal (the viewer is invited into a concrete test) and Social Proof (the “3005 star reviews” creates a ready-made benchmark to check against). Because the outcome is uncertain (“if it lives up”), Curiosity Gap keeps attention on the pending result until the evidence is shown, reducing the chance they scroll away mid-test.

Visual Direction

This beat blends initial surprise with product reveal and social proof. It opens with an authentic, delighted close-up reaction, then immediately cuts to product in use, followed by the product in packaging. Interspersed end cards feature bold, uppercase text reinforcing key verbal claims, culminating in a screen recording of positive reviews.

BEAT 02

Relatability Setup

CONTEXT00:09.800:26.2 · 8 shots

The speaker establishes shared lived experience by saying, “I’ve struggled with a sore neck and back for so long.” They then connect it to a common work context: “I work in an office… constantly staring down at my screen,” framing the pain as a predictable result of desk life.

Why this works:This leverages Relatability Setup by matching the viewer’s likely situation (office screen-staring) and emotional state (long-term pain), which increases attention and lowers skepticism. Because the setup is personal rather than generic, it creates a sense of “this person gets it,” making the later purchase claim feel more relevant and worth listening to.

Visual Direction

The visual journey here transitions from problem-setting to solution-introduction. It features the speaker emoting discomfort about neck and back pain through various relatable hand gestures, alternating with close-ups of the product packaging. End cards with impactful text reinforce the problem's chronic nature and the product's promised relief, subtly contrasting with wired alternatives via picture-in-picture.

BEAT 03

Complexity Overload

TENSION00:26.200:34.4 · 3 shots

It contrasts “tons of wires” and a “really complicated” setup with buying the wireless alternative because it “looked incredibly easy to use.” This frames the purchasing decision as escaping complexity, pulling the viewer out of confusion and into a clear, simpler path right in the moment.

Why this works:This leverages Complexity Overload by making the prior option feel cognitively heavy (“tons of wires,” “complicated”). It also uses Self-Do​ubt Trigger in a light way: if something looks hard, the viewer worries they won’t be able to use it successfully, so the promise of “wireless” and “incredibly easy to use” removes that uncertainty and keeps attention locked.

Visual Direction

This beat is dominated by three consecutive end cards, each featuring bold, uppercase text against a clean, minimal white background. Product imagery (application, assembly, peeling) is integrated into each card, providing a static visual demonstration of the 'wireless' and 'easy to use' claims made in the voiceover. The focus is on clear, step-by-step instruction within a graphic frame.

BEAT 04

Micro Walkthrough

DELIVERY00:34.401:01.3 · 12 shots

The speaker gives a rapid, step-by-step setup walkthrough: “all you do is get the electrode pad… stick the control unit on… peel the protective cover away… stick it wherever you feel pain… press the on button… it has six different modes.” In the same beat they add instant usage feedback (“Oh wow that feels insane!” / “I can feel the pain melting away”), so the viewer experiences the procedure as something they could replicate immediately, not just watch.

Why this works:This leverages Procedural Fluency—by spelling out the exact sequence, it reduces mental effort and makes the action feel executable. It also uses Narrative Transport/Simulation: the concrete “do this, then this” flow plus immediate sensory claims (“stimul... nerves… twitch” / “pain melting away”) helps the viewer simulate the outcome, increasing staying power. Finally, it triggers Risk Reversal by explicitly stating “It doesn't hurt at all,” lowering uncertainty so the viewer can comfortably imagine trying it.

Visual Direction

This beat unfolds as a detailed product demonstration, blending close-ups of tactile interactions (peeling, sticking, pressing buttons) with end cards that reinforce instructions and benefits. The visuals emphasize the product's stickiness, wireless application, and adjustable modes, showing the user's surprised delight and the discreet nature of the device in use. The production is clean, focusing on clarity.

BEAT 05

Fear → Relief

SHIFT01:01.301:09.7 · 3 shots

The speaker flips the situation from dread to comfort: “I hate taking pain meds all the time” is immediately followed by relief framing—“This is such an incredible natural pain relief.” The beat moves the viewer’s emotional interpretation from enduring constant medication to having an easier, more desirable alternative in mind.

Why this works:This leverages Fear → Relief by acknowledging an aversive burden (“I hate taking pain meds all the time”) and resolving it with calming reassurance (“such an incredible natural pain relief”). That reduction in emotional threat makes the viewer more willing to keep watching, because the brain treats the message as a solution to an unpleasant problem, not just an informational claim.

Visual Direction

This beat primarily consists of end cards with bold, uppercase text, reinforcing key benefits. Product visuals are strategically integrated into these static frames: demonstrating reapplication of the protective film, a hero shot of the product case, and an open case revealing the pads. The visual world is clean, minimal, and driven by graphic information paired with product presence.
